Comparison between Intel Core i9-10900X and Intel Pentium G3460

Both CPUs are manufactured by Intel. Intel Core i9-10900X has a higher base speed of 3.7 GHz compared to Intel Pentium G3460's 3.5 GHz. Intel Core i9-10900X has a higher turbo speed of 4.7 GHz compared to Intel Pentium G3460's GHz. Intel Core i9-10900X has more cores (10) compared to Intel Pentium G3460's 2 cores. Intel Core i9-10900X supports more threads (20) compared to Intel Pentium G3460's 2 threads.

Both CPUs belong to the same class: Desktop. Intel Core i9-10900X uses the FCLGA2066 socket, while Intel Pentium G3460 uses the LGA1150 socket. Intel Core i9-10900X was launched in Q4 2019, while Intel Pentium G3460 was launched in Q3 2014. Intel Core i9-10900X has a larger L3 cache of 19 MB compared to Intel Pentium G3460's 3 MB.

Pro's and Con's

Intel Core i9-10900X – Pros and Cons

Pros:

  • Newer Release: The Intel Core i9-10900X was launched more recently (Q4 2019) compared to the Intel Pentium G3460 (Q3 2014). This means it benefits from the latest advancements in technology, improved efficiency, and potentially better software optimization.
  • Higher Base Clock Speed: The Intel Core i9-10900X has a higher base clock speed of 3.7 GHz compared to the Intel Pentium G3460's 3.5 GHz. This results in better performance for single-threaded tasks and general responsiveness.
  • Higher Turbo Boost Speed: The Intel Core i9-10900X supports a higher turbo boost speed of 4.7 GHz compared to the Intel Pentium G3460's GHz. This allows for better performance during peak workloads.
  • Faster Single-Core Performance: With a single-threaded performance score of 2675, the Intel Core i9-10900X outperforms the Intel Pentium G3460 (score: 1986). This makes it better suited for tasks that rely on single-core performance, such as gaming or everyday productivity.
  • Larger L3 Cache: The Intel Core i9-10900X features a larger L3 cache of 19MB compared to the Intel Pentium G3460's 3MB. A larger cache improves performance in memory-intensive tasks, such as video editing or 3D rendering, by reducing latency and speeding up data access.
  • Higher CPU Mark Score: The Intel Core i9-10900X has a higher CPU Mark score of 39.75 compared to the Intel Pentium G3460's 17.85. This indicates better overall performance across a wide range of tasks.

Cons:

  • Higher Power Consumption: The Intel Core i9-10900X has a higher TDP of 165W compared to the Intel Pentium G3460's 53W. This means it may consume more power, leading to higher energy costs and potentially more heat generation, which could require better cooling solutions.
